Watch What Happens Live
Watch What Happens Live is an interactive series hosted by Bravo programming executive Andy Cohen, Bravo's Senior Vice President of Original Programming and Development, is best known to viewers as the host of the network's often explosive Watch What Happens reunion specials. Watch What Happens originally debuted as a live online show on www.bravotv.com. Watch What Happens welcomes guests from some of the cable network's most popular series, as well as other entertainment stars, to chat about pop culture and celebrities in the news!

On the Case with Paula Zahn
Led by Emmy Award-winning journalist Paula Zahn, On the Case features in-depth interviews and original reporting that go beyond the headlines in search of fascinating mysteries from within our nation's justice system. Each episode is highlighted by Zahn's riveting exclusive interviews, which draw out different viewpoints from the people personally connected to tragedies that rocked their local community and the investigations that attempted to piece together the truth On the Case with Paula Zahn.

The Twelve
Twelve citizens are called for jury duty on a high-profile murder trial as traumatizing as it is controversial, in which a woman stands accused of killing her sister's child.
As time goes by, the murder trial becomes a trial, not only for the accused, but for the jury members themselves.
Behind the façade of their anonymity, these twelve ordinary people bring with them their own histories. Lives that are as complex as the trial, full of fractured dreams, shameful secrets, hope, fears, personal trauma and prejudice.
